City Saw a 20 Percent Reduction in Auto Theft in 2008
Would-be car thieves be warned: Attempting to steal a vehicle in Houston has gotten more difficult as law enforcement uses technology to combat auto theft.
A car is stolen in Houston every two seconds, compared to every 28.8 nationally, according to the FBI.
That's one reason Houston police are using decoy vehicles to catch criminals.
